使用VPN后无法连接网络?常见原因与解决方案全解析
作为一名网络工程师,我经常遇到用户在使用VPN(虚拟私人网络)后突然发现无法访问互联网的问题,这不仅影响工作效率,还可能让人误以为是网络服务提供商(ISP)或设备本身出了故障,大多数情况下,问题出在VPN配置不当、路由冲突或防火墙策略上,本文将深入分析常见原因,并提供实用的排查步骤和解决方法,帮助你快速恢复网络连接。
我们要明确一个关键点:使用VPN时,你的流量会被加密并重新路由到远程服务器,这意味着本地网络设置可能会受到影响,最常见的原因之一是“默认路由被覆盖”,当VPN客户端启动时,它会自动修改系统的路由表,把所有流量都导向VPN服务器,而忽略了你原本的网关,如果你的VPN配置错误,比如未启用“绕过本地网络”(Split Tunneling)选项,就会导致无法访问公网资源。
DNS解析异常也是常见故障,很多VPN服务会强制使用其自定义的DNS服务器,如果这些DNS服务器不稳定或被屏蔽(例如在中国大陆地区),会导致网页打不开、域名解析失败等问题,你可以尝试手动更换为公共DNS,如Google DNS(8.8.8.8 和 8.8.4.4)或阿里云DNS(223.5.5.5),看看是否能恢复正常。
第三,防火墙或杀毒软件拦截也常被忽视,某些安全软件会在检测到大量数据通过VPN隧道时误判为威胁,从而阻止连接,建议暂时关闭防火墙或添加例外规则,允许VPN程序通信,Windows系统自带的“Windows Defender 防火墙”或第三方工具如McAfee、卡巴斯基等,都可能对UDP/TCP端口造成限制,需检查相关策略。
第四,IP地址冲突或DHCP获取失败也可能导致断网,当你连接到VPN后,设备可能获得一个新的IP地址段(通常属于私有网络范围),此时若本地路由器没有正确分配网关或子网掩码,也会引发连通性问题,可以尝试重启路由器或手动释放/刷新IP地址(命令行输入 ipconfig /release 和 ipconfig /renew)。
第五,不同平台上的表现差异也需要关注,在Windows系统中,有些VPN协议(如OpenVPN、L2TP/IPSec)可能因驱动不兼容而失败;而在macOS或Linux中,则可能需要手动配置证书或密钥文件,务必确认所使用的VPN客户端版本是否最新,以及是否支持当前操作系统。
如果你已经排除了上述所有可能性仍无法解决问题,请考虑以下操作:
- 断开VPN,测试原生网络是否正常;
- 更换不同的VPN服务器节点(有时某个节点负载过高或封禁);
- 使用其他可靠的VPN服务进行对比测试;
- 联系VPN服务商的技术支持,提供日志文件协助诊断。
使用VPN后无法上网并非无解难题,而是典型的网络配置冲突问题,掌握基本的网络排错技能——包括查看路由表(route print)、测试DNS(nslookup)、检查防火墙状态(firewall.cpl)——将极大提升你独立解决问题的能力,不要盲目重装系统,先从最简单的配置调整做起,往往事半功倍,作为网络工程师,我们始终相信:每个问题背后都有逻辑可循,耐心排查,终能找到答案。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速
@版权声明
转载原创文章请注明转载自半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速,网站地址:https://m.web-banxianjiasuqi.com/